A's Designate Janson Junk For Assignment
Briefly

Janson Junk's short-lived tenure with the A's ended after a disastrous outing, prompting the team to recall Brady Basso from Triple-A Las Vegas as his replacement.
Despite a poor first showing with the A's, Junk has shown promise in Triple-A, previously logging impressive statistics with an overall 3.60 ERA this season.
Brady Basso, now back with the A's, made a solid impression in Double-A earlier this season, featuring a 2.84 ERA with an impressive strikeout rate.
Junk's troubling outing raises questions about his major league viability, having seen his ERA balloon to 6.75 after allowing seven earned runs without recording an out.
